The seventeenth amendment to the US Constitution, which was ratified on May 31, 1913, made it so that senators would be elected directly to the senate by voters. Before this Senators were appointed by the state legislators (Legislators from Delaware would choose the Senators for Delaware etc.). Before this only the representatives were directly elected. The amendment was one of the parts of the platform for the populists and later, the progressives.
